  @Provides
  @Singleton
  public EventInjector provideEventInjector() {
    // On API 16 and above, android uses input manager to inject events. On API < 16,
    // they use Window Manager. So we need to create our InjectionStrategy depending on the api
    // level. Instrumentation does not check if the event presses went through by checking the
    // boolean return value of injectInputEvent, which is why we created this class to better
    // handle lost/dropped press events. Instrumentation cannot be used as a fallback strategy,
    // since this will be executed on the main thread.
    int sdkVersion = Build.VERSION.SDK_INT;
    EventInjectionStrategy injectionStrategy = null;
    if (sdkVersion >= 16) { // Use InputManager for API level 16 and up.
      InputManagerEventInjectionStrategy strategy = new InputManagerEventInjectionStrategy();
      strategy.initialize();
      injectionStrategy = strategy;
    } else if (sdkVersion >= 7) {
      // else Use WindowManager for API level 15 through 7.
      WindowManagerEventInjectionStrategy strategy = new WindowManagerEventInjectionStrategy();
      strategy.initialize();
      injectionStrategy = strategy;
    } else {
      throw new RuntimeException(
          "API Level 6 and below is not supported. You are running: " + sdkVersion);
    }
    return new EventInjector(injectionStrategy);
  }
